Determine how much this home would cost to replace: 2,600 square feet at $86.00 per square foot

Answer: $223,600

Step-by-step explanation:

Since it is $86 per square foot and you're replacing the 2,600 square foot house you would just take 2,600 × 86 and get 223,600 dollars.
